Bitcoin ETF has seen a continuous net inflow of funds for 12 days, while the single-day net inflow of Ether ETF continues to lead over Bitcoin ETF.
On July 19, according to SoSoValue data, the total net inflow of Bitcoin spot ETF in the United States yesterday was $363 million, marking 12 consecutive days of net inflow of funds.
Among them, BlackRock's Bitcoin ETF IBIT saw a net inflow of nearly 497 million USD yesterday, with a total cumulative net inflow of 56.97 billion USD for IBIT.
